A miracle! Documented! A man in West London, England, had a six-pack of eggs, which he was making into an omlette. Each one was a double yolk egg. According to the British Egg Information Service, the "odds" of any one egg being a double yolker is about one in one thousand (they do eggs, so we'll give them the benefit of the doubt).
Do the math, that comes out to a statistical probability of one trillion (that's a US-style trillion, with twelve zeros, not a British-style trillion with a lot more).
The BBC explains why this is -not- proof of a miracle, however. http://www.bbc.co.uk/news/magazine-16118149
